I want my money back... (Free verse) by Blindproject217
You told me I should think about leaving. Every time you checked your watch the light reflected in my eyes. Such a subtle hint you must have thought. Conversation struck up and abruptly crashed into a dead end. Like my car you wrecked and then apologized about for a week. You must have thought I'd lord it over you, because the next week you said you needed space. I said join NASA. You didnt laugh. Now I'm not sure what I'm begging for. You sigh and roll your eyes becuase you know I hate it. Your wrong about most things, but I say your right so you wont be embarrassed. You direct me to the door with such familiarity. I remeber how good you were with directions. Funny that you always made me read the map. The side panel of my car is a different color. An embarrassing reminder of you. Somehow I still think of turning around. But I wont, I'll just go back to my apartment that you hated. I'll go back to bare walls and lamps without shades. I'll go back to shadows.
